Connecting your Domain to Google Workspace

Authors list

Prerequisites

  • Your DNS records are not hosted externally or 3rd party

  • Your domain nameservers are using ns1.vdns.au and ns2.vdns.au

To connect the domain to Google Workspace

  1. Log into Domain Panel: https://domains.micron21.com/login

  2. Navigate to “Domains” in the side panel.

  3. Click the Name of your domain name then scroll down and click the “Manage DNS” button.

  4. You can then click the “Add New Record” button to create a new entry.

  5. Set the DNS type from one of the DropDown options (listed above) and enter any required details from your host.
